    Appendix G Comments and Responses

    This document is Appendix G of the Seattle-Tacoma International Airport Part 150 Noise Study, compiling public comments and official responses gathered during the study's development. It covers a wide range of topics organized into three main areas: Part 150 regulations and noise exposure maps (including noise metrics, flight tracks, and FAA guidelines), current airport operations and community concerns (such as flight paths, nighttime operations, and the sound insulation program), and miscellaneous issues like health effects, air quality, and property values. Comments were collected through multiple channels including public open houses, workshops, the study website, and email.

    Appendix H Official Noise Exposure Maps

    This document presents the official Noise Exposure Maps (NEMs) for Seattle-Tacoma International Airport (SEA), developed as part of the FAA Part 150 noise study. It includes maps showing 2022 existing noise conditions and projected 2032 future conditions, along with the flight tracks used in the Aviation Environmental Design Tool (AEDT) modeling for both north and south flow operations. The maps illustrate the geographic extent of aircraft noise impacts across surrounding communities, including Seattle, Burien, SeaTac, Tukwila, and Des Moines.

    ANES 2026 AWG: Orange County Community Proactive Involvement in Addressing Change (Post NexGen) — Commercial Airline Requested Departure Procedure Adjustments at SNA

    Aviation Noise and Emissions Symposium (ANES) Aviation Working Group (AWG) presentation on seven specific community requests to airlines to mitigate departure noise at John Wayne Airport (SNA/Orange County). Covers NADP-1 steep departure procedures (1.2 dB reduction), STAYY4 two-turn procedure approved by FAA, 1200-foot throttle cutback, further power reduction at 1200 feet altitude initiated April 2024

    Aviation Environmental Design Tool (AEDT) version 3g supplemental manual: Quick start tutorial

    The Aviation Environmental Design Tool (AEDT) Version 3g is a Federal Aviation Administration software system used to model aircraft operations and calculate their environmental impacts, including noise, emissions, and fuel consumption. This Quick Start Tutorial guides users through building basic noise and emissions studies, covering steps such as adding airports, creating flight tracks, setting up receptors, and running metric results. The tool is relevant to airport noise policy analysis, as it provides a structured method for quantifying and evaluating the environmental effects of aviation activity around airports like Sea-Tac.

    Integrated Noise Model (INM)

    The Integrated Noise Model (INM), developed by ATAC Corporation for the FAA, was the standard computer tool used to assess aircraft noise impacts near airports like Sea-Tac, calculating noise exposure contours and predicted sound levels at sensitive locations such as schools and hospitals. It was required for airport noise compatibility planning under FAR Part 150 and environmental reviews under the National Environmental Policy Act until it was replaced by the Aviation Environmental Design Tool (AEDT) in May 2015. Though no longer valid for regulatory use in the U.S., the INM was used by over 1,000 users in 65 countries to evaluate the noise effects of runway changes, flight routing, air traffic procedures, and shifts in aircraft fleet mix.
